From buttondown-mgmt
Update an existing template in the local template store — edit body, change subject, scope, audience, or tags. Bumps the `updated` timestamp in frontmatter.
npx claudepluginhub danielrosehill/claude-code-plugins --plugin buttondown-mgmtThis skill uses the workspace's default tool permissions.
1. List existing templates (`ls $DATA_ROOT/templates/*.md`) and ask which to update if not specified.
Creates new Angular apps using Angular CLI with flags for routing, SSR, SCSS, prefixes, and AI config. Follows best practices for modern TypeScript/Angular development. Use when starting Angular projects.
Provides UI/UX resources: 50+ styles, color palettes, font pairings, guidelines, charts for web/mobile across React, Next.js, Vue, Svelte, Tailwind, React Native, Flutter. Aids planning, building, reviewing interfaces.
Executes ctx7 CLI to fetch up-to-date library documentation, manage AI coding skills (install/search/generate/remove/suggest), and configure Context7 MCP. Useful for current API refs, skill handling, or agent setup.
Share bugs, ideas, or general feedback.
ls $DATA_ROOT/templates/*.md) and ask which to update if not specified.global ↔ newsletter slug — validate against config.json)<file>.tmp, then mv). Update the updated timestamp; preserve created.If the user wants to rename a template, treat as: copy → update → delete old. Confirm before deleting.
Out of scope for this skill. If asked, delete via shell after confirming with the user.